roadrunner Development Camp
Wed Aug 30, 2017, 11:00 AM - 4:00 PM
Location: Hespeler Arena
The Cambridge roadrunners are once again excited to offer this great opportunity to all Novice, Atom, Peewee, Bantam and Midget players in our organization.

The roadrunners are holding a four-day mini camp, running August 28th to August 31st, 2017 from 11am to 4pm at the Hespeler Arena. Girls will be engaged in both on and off ice activities focused on developing their hockey skills.

The on-ice sessions will focus on power skating, other skating techniques and puck control. While the off-ice sessions will focus on shooting, stick handling, dryland and other fun activities.

The Cambridge roadrunners are also pleased to announce these two programs, who will be facilitating the training.

L. McIntosh Hockey Female Development – founder and head instructor Laura McIntosh, a member in the Hockey Canada Program, member of Canada’s Under-18 National Team 2008 (Competed in the first ever IIHF U-18 Worlds, won Silver Medal), will conduct the on - ice training.


Stoke Strength and Conditioning – Their mission is to inspire people to lead happier and healthier lives and to provide people of all ages and abilities the tools they need to reach their goals. Located at 1600 Industrial Road, Unit 14B, Cambridge, ON will conduct our dry land training.

Rivulettes Women's Jr. Hockey Team - members from our own Jr. team will be out to join the girls during the outside activities. (shooting, passing and road hockey games)

We can offer this at a cost of only $40 for all four (4) days.

We are attempting to facilitate a goalie development portion to this camp and all goalies are encouraged to register to properly gage interest. (goalie development will be prior to player times)

Players will be responsible to bring their own on ice equipment, (including a jersey), off ice wear (weather appropriate clothing, running shoes), street hockey stick and a snack for between sessions.
